Breckland Cottage Wilbraham Road, Six Mile Bottom, Newmarket, CB8 0UW is a freehold detached property built before 1900. The property offers approximately 1,776 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have six b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£499,414 , which equates to approximately £281 per square foot. It was last sold on 20 Mar 2015 for £380,000. Since then, the value has increased by £119,414, representing a 31.4% increase, or approximately 2.9% per year.

Breckland Cottage Wilbraham Road, Six Mile Bottom, Newmarket, South Cambridgeshire, Cambridgeshire, CB8 0UW has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of E, based on the latest assessment carried out on 13 Aug 2020.

This property uses an oil-fired boiler with radiators as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from the main heating system, though the cylinder has no thermostat.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 11 Jun 2009. The rating of E rem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 2.5%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The hot water system was changed from from main system, no cylinderstat, no cylinderstat to from main system, no cylinder thermostat, with its energy efficiency changing from average to poor.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 75 mm loft insulation to pitched, 250 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from average to good.
  • The windows were upgraded from partial double glazing to fully double glazed.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 20%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 75%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from poor to very good.
